Norms and Standards for the Safe Operations of the Tourism Sector in the context of COVID-19 and other related pandemics

11. Norms and Standards for Food Service

 

Operational and Staff Preparedness

 

A person in charge of food services must—

(a) develop a prevention plan for the attraction business;
(b) implement protocols and guidelines for staff, including health checks;
(c) integrate technologies  to  enable  automation such  as contactless touchpoints and payments, where possible;
(d) introduce a COVID-19 and other related pandemics contingency plan, should a new case emerge;
(e) train staff to ensure the execution of operational plans; and
(f) monitor the well-being of the employees and encourage them to follow the latest advice of health authorities.

 

Safe experience

 

A person in charge of food services must—

(a) implement enhanced sanitation,disinfection, and deep cleaning;
(b) implement  physical distancing measures with regard to seating distribution, booths, aisles and gathering size in line with government
(c) guidelines;
(d) reduce the capacity of venues to a limit appropriate to allow for social distancing and as required by local regulations;
(e) implement customer processes including participant information, to ensure physical distancing; and
(f) implement measures to ensure food safety and hygiene.
